Output 07d3bd8d65251e1a44ced02ac3611505ddb5d3d445581ccff7a0d67a9e522112:40

value
939617
script pubkey
OP_0 OP_PUSHBYTES_20 a91b18d62d4e171d7f687e37678237af77efa669
address
bc1q4yd3343dfct36lmg0cmk0q3h4am7lfnf6tkjgr
transaction
07d3bd8d65251e1a44ced02ac3611505ddb5d3d445581ccff7a0d67a9e522112
confirmations
39390
spent
true